Indoor humidity has become an increasingly common concern in homes where older cooling systems struggle to maintain balanced airflow and moisture removal during extended periods of heat. In many cases, systems continue cooling air while failing to regulate moisture levels effectively, resulting in uneven indoor comfort and higher energy usage.

Research Continues To Highlight the Impact of Proper System Design

According to guidance from the U.S. Department of Energy, properly sized cooling systems improve both energy efficiency and humidity control by allowing equipment to run longer, more stable cooling cycles. Oversized systems may cool homes quickly but often fail to remove enough indoor moisture because they shut off too rapidly.

Improper Sizing Creates Long-Term Performance Challenges

This issue has become increasingly noticeable in homes operating with aging equipment or systems installed without detailed load calculations. Short cycling, uneven airflow, and excess indoor humidity often appear together when systems are not properly matched to the property’s cooling requirements.

Correct sizing remains one of the most important factors influencing long-term HVAC performance, especially in regions with prolonged cooling demand and elevated humidity levels.

Modern equipment featuring variable-speed operation has also contributed to improved indoor moisture management. These systems adjust output gradually based on indoor demand, allowing longer operating cycles that support more consistent humidity removal.

Predictive Maintenance Research Shows Strong Reliability Improvements

Additional research published in Energy Reports by Es-Sakali et al. (2022) found that predictive maintenance strategies can reduce HVAC system breakdowns by up to 70–75% while also decreasing breakdown duration by 35–45%.

Preventive Maintenance Helps Support Indoor Comfort

These findings reinforce the growing industry focus on airflow inspections, filter replacement schedules, and system performance monitoring as essential components of long-term cooling efficiency.

Restricted airflow caused by clogged filters, damaged ductwork, or neglected maintenance often limits a system’s ability to regulate moisture effectively. As airflow decreases, cooling equipment may operate longer without improving comfort conditions indoors.

Consistent maintenance has increasingly become tied not only to equipment longevity but also to indoor air quality and humidity regulation in air conditioning installation services.

Humidity Concerns Are Influencing Replacement Decisions

As homeowners become more aware of indoor air quality and comfort conditions, humidity management has become a larger factor in replacement discussions involving air conditioner installation and complete HVAC upgrades.

In many homes, humidity issues become noticeable before complete equipment failure occurs. Condensation around vents, uneven room temperatures, and persistent damp indoor air are often early signs that cooling systems are no longer operating efficiently.

Installation Quality Continues To Influence Performance Outcomes

Industry professionals continue emphasizing that installation quality directly affects humidity control, airflow balance, and long-term efficiency. Incorrect refrigerant levels, airflow restrictions, and improper duct configurations can all reduce moisture removal performance even when modern equipment is installed.

For this reason, many homeowners evaluating air conditioning installation projects are focusing more closely on load calculations, duct inspections, and airflow testing during system replacement planning.
